Supporting testosterone levels can be a crucial factor in fertility for men. Here are five fertility-friendly nutrients and foods that can help boost testosterone production:

1. Zinc-Rich Foods

Zinc is a vital mineral that plays a significant role in testosterone synthesis. Foods such as oysters, pumpkin seeds, and legumes are excellent sources of zinc. Incorporating these into your diet can help promote hormonal balance.

2. Healthy Fats

Monounsaturated and omega-3 fatty acids are essential for maintaining optimal testosterone levels. Foods like avocados, olive oil, and fatty fish such as salmon can provide these beneficial fats. These not only support hormone health but also contribute to overall reproductive wellness.

3. Vitamin D Sources

Vitamin D deficiency has been linked to lower testosterone levels. Sunlight exposure is a natural way to boost vitamin D, but you can also consume fortified dairy products, egg yolks, and fatty fish. Ensuring adequate vitamin D intake can be pivotal for your hormonal health.

4. Cruciferous Vegetables

Vegetables like broccoli, cauliflower, and Brussels sprouts contain compounds that can help regulate estrogen levels, thereby supporting testosterone production. Including these in your meals can be a great way to enhance hormonal balance.

5. B Vitamins

B vitamins, particularly B6 and B12, are important for testosterone production. Foods such as whole grains, eggs, and meats are rich in these vitamins. A well-rounded intake of B vitamins can contribute significantly to male reproductive health.
